PV wire (photovoltaic wire) is the industry standard for connecting solar panels. It's a single-conductor wire designed specifically for the harsh environment of a rooftop or ground-mount array.
Why PV wire instead of regular THHN or USE-2?
- UV resistant – Won't crack or break down after years of direct sunlight
- Weather sealed – Rated for wet locations, rain, and snow
- High temperature rating – Handles rooftop heat without degrading
- Flexible – Easy to route between panels and through combiner boxes
What it's not for: PV wire is not rated for direct burial or for running inside a building without conduit. For those applications, you'll want USE-2 or THHN.
Available in: 10 AWG and 12 AWG (the standard sizes for panel interconnects), in various colors including black, red, and white.
